So here we are with another GTX 580 review which just so happens to be the second of five which will be hitting the pages of Hardware Canucks over the next few weeks. Typically, early summer is a relatively slow time for new architecture introductions in the graphics card world and many board partners use this time to expand their lineups with new twists on existing cards.

During Computex, we’ll surely see all manner of custom cards (many of which will never be available in North American retail channels) but Gigabyte has pre-empted much of their competition by already introducing their upper crust single GPU card: the GTX 580 Super Overclock.

GTX580-SOC-64.jpg

Much like the MSI Lightning (and the upcoming Lightning X) we reviewed a little while back, Gigabyte has swung for the fences with this card. There’s a substantial overclock on the core which should result in a good framerate boost. For whatever reason Gigabyte increased memory speeds by an almost nonsensical 100Mhz. Unfortunately, the SoC “only” comes with 1.5GB of onboard memory which could cause an issue since the competition has begun showing off 3GB designs.

GTX580-SOC-1.jpg

One of the main selling points of the Super Overclock series has always been their high-end heatsink design and this card is no different. This Windforce 3X design uses a large vapor chamber that’s topped with a pair of 8mm heatpipes and a three 80mm fans. Unlike some custom designs, this heatsink doesn’t stick out over the custom PCB’s edge which is good considering the SoC is a good ½” longer than the reference GTX 580.


Along with the usual GPU Gauntlet sorting process and Ultra Durable VGA+ design, Gigabyte has also added some extras for overclockers. There’s an Extreme Dual BIOS button which switches between the standard Gigabyte SoC BIOS and one that is tailored to work around the GF110’s cold bug when under LN2. The card does have to be uninstalled to actually access this button but we don’t expect it to be used all that much anyways.

Voltage read points are conspicuous by their absence considering Gigabyte claims this card has them. We couldn't find them in any easily-accessible location, that's for sure.

GTX580-SOC-5.jpg

All of this cutting edge GPU technology is held together by an extensive 14-phase PWM design which is linked up to LED’s on the PCB’s underside. This PWM is also helped along with NEC / Tokin Prodalizer film capacitors mounted next to the aforementioned LEDs.

Naturally, the Super Overclock boasts a hefty entry cost. At $540 it is a good $20 more than MSI’s Lightning which may cause a bit of an issue since both cards should perform identically and offer almost the same feature sets. Can Gigabyte really justify even the slightest premium over the Lightning? We’re going to find out.

Aliens Versus Predator (DX11)

Aliens Versus Predator (DX11)


When benchmarking Aliens Versus Predator, we played through the whole game in order to find a section which represents a “worst case” scenario. We finally decided to include “The Refinery” level which includes a large open space and several visual features that really tax a GPU. For this run-through, we start from within the first tunnel, make our way over the bridge on the right (blowing up several propane tanks in the process), head back over the bridge and finally climb the tower until the first run-in with an Alien. In total, the time spent is about four minutes per run. Framerates are recorded with FRAPS.

Just Cause 2 (DX10)

Just Cause 2 (DX10)


Just Cause 2 has quickly become known as one of the best-looking games on the market and while it doesn’t include DX11 support, it uses the full stable of DX10 features to deliver a truly awe-inspiring visual experience. For this benchmark we used the car chase scene directly following the Casino Assault level. This scene includes perfectly scripted events, some of the most GPU-strenuous effects and lasts a little less than four minutes. We chose to not use the in-game benchmarking tool due to its inaccuracy when it comes to depicting actual gameplay performance.

Lost Planet 2 (DX11)

Lost Planet 2 (DX11)


Lost Planet is a game that was originally released on consoles but in its port over to the PC, it gained some highly impressive DX11 features. For this benchmark, we forgo the two built-in tools and instead use a 2 minute gameplay sequence from the second level in the first chapter. The reason we use this level is because it makes use of three elements that are seen throughout the game world: jungles, water and open terrain.
